A Basket Of Fruits

A Basket of Fruits is a delightful and colorful sight, filled with an array of delicious and nutritious produce. This collective noun phrase refers to a collection of ripe and juicy fruits carefully arranged in a pleasing arrangement within a woven or decorative basket. It exudes a vibrant aura, captivating both the eyes and the senses. A basket of fruits might include a variety of apples, oranges, pears, plums, berries, or any other seasonal fruits that possess a burst of natural sweetness.
